Palestinian woman killed in Nablus fighting


Three security forces were injured in clashes

 News Desk

A woman was killed and three soldiers were injured Wednesday in renewed clashes between Palestinian security forces and gunmen in the West Bank city of Nablus, according to the city’s governor. 
Akram Rajoub said a 39 year-old woman was shot dead in the violence that broke out after gunmen opened fire on the governorate building in the city. 
"Three security forces were also injured in the clashes,” he said in a statement. 
In recent months, Nablus has seen repeated clashes between security forces and gunmen. 
In August, two Palestinian security forces were killed in a shootout with armed men in the old city of Nablus.
